    I have a 2007 Tacoma 4.0/6 speed, 4WD and need your help with small electrical problems.
    1, The horn doesn't work. I have changed the relay and the 10A fuse under the hood.
    2, The fan motor doesn't work. I have changed the relay and 15A fuse (marked A/F HEATER?) under the hood.
    Both the horn & the fan failed previously and then worked again after a brief period without doing any repair other than removing and inspecting the fuses. They did not work directly after checking the fuses.
    3, The Air Bag warning light has been on for quite some time. To the best I can remember the warning light came on after a very fast trip down a long a 4WD road.

    You need to do some trouble-shooting to narrow down the problem. For example:

    For the horn ... unplug the connector from the horn itself and see if it is getting power when your buddy pushes on the horn. Not sure about your 2007, but on my 1999, the ground is thru the body of the horn to the frame.
